About the adventure
You've been invited to the princess's birthday and discover the theft of a priceless gift - a fallen star powered tiara. It falls to your group to discover what truly happened and who the culprit really is. Will your journey be shaped by Hope or Fear? Can you survive the dangerous politics while uncovering what lies ahead? Join us for this beginner-friendly, story-rich Daggerheart one-shot and celebrate what makes this system stand out.

About me
Hello! I'm Britt. I delved into tabletop gaming during COVID and never looked back. I've been Game Mastering since June 2021, and I started playing in September 2021. I'm well-versed in D&D 5e and am learning Daggerheart, along with other table top systems. My tables are welcoming spaces for everyone, regardless of age, race, gender, or experience level. I've hosted games for players ALL ages with the youngest at 6, from newcomers to veterans. They're always LGBTQ+ friendly, and my pronouns are she/her. In our games, we come together to weave stories, and I'm here to facilitate that. Whether it's a one-shot or a mini-campaign, players drive the narrative, and I'm here to guide and enhance their storytelling. We play on Roll20 and use Discord for voice communication. Character creation, if needed, can be done on D&D Beyond for easy access to resource books. Feel free to share any homebrew ideas; we can create the perfect character and story together.

Creating your character
Players are welcome to bring their own level three character. Let me know and we will get them connected via the campaign link in Demiplane. Otherwise, premade characters will be available. These are the choices and will be given on a first come\first serve basis: Marlowe Fairwind, Loreborne Elf Sorcerer Barnacle, Underborne Ribbet Rogue Garrick Reed, Highborne Human Warrior Khari Nix, Wanderborne Giant Guardian Varian Soto, Wildborne Katari Ranger Each of their character packets will be posted to review in the Discord.
